Asia-Plus

Uzbek National Air Company "Uzbekiston Havo Yullari" changed schedule of flights on the direction Tashkent-Dushanbe-Tashkent.

"Flights for the period from 2 to 30 September this year will be carried out on Saturdays on comfortable A320” airliners,"Uzbekiston Havo Yullari” website said.

Regular flights between Dushanbe and Tashkent started in April this year. The first flight took place on April 11. Flights on the route Tashkent-Dushanbe-Tashkent are carried out by the Uzbek airline "Uzbekistan Havo Yullari".

Initially, the Uzbek airline performed two flights a week – on Tuesdays and Fridays. Now there is only Tuesday.

"The Uzbek airline went on reduction of flights because of low passenger traffic," said Transport Minister of Tajikistan.

Earlier, the airline was also informed that the reason for the reduction of flights to Tajikistan was a low passenger flow, rejecting the political background, adding that the flight became unprofitable.

The right to fly on this route from the Tajik side was provided to Somon Air, but it did not start flights to Tashkent

"The airline carries out preparatory work it is engaged in accreditation of its representation in Tashkent. Perhaps, if there is enough passenger traffic, the airline will start flights to Tashkent" said Transport Minister of the Republic of Tajikistan Khudoyor Khudoyorzoda.

Recall that the cost of a ticket for a plane to Tashkent is $ 140. 

Recently, the post of the head of "Uzbekistan Havo Yullari" left Valery Tyan. The airline's CEO appointed Ulugbek Rozukulov, who on August 23, by presidential decree, was dismissed from his post as Uzbekistan's deputy prime minister and chairman of the board of “Uzavtosanoat”. Valery Tyan headed the National Airline since June 2002. Before that, from 1998 to 2002, he was in charge of the State Inspectorate for Safety Supervision.
